Obama Administration outlines strategy for reduction of methane emissions

Green Car Congress

EPA will solicit input from independent experts through a series of technical white papers, and in the fall of 2014, EPA will determine how best to pursue further methane reductions from these sources. If EPA decides to develop additional regulations, it will complete those regulations by the end of 2016.

Southern California Edison introduces clean energy proposal to meet state’s climate, air quality goals; >7M EVs (24%) by 2030

Green Car Congress

SCE describes its Clean Power and Electrification Pathway in a white paper. Southern California Edison has proposed an integrated strategic framework for the state of California to meet its ambitious climate and air quality goals.
